Engineer - Warranty and Reliability
The Warranty & Reliability Engineer owns the end-to-end warranty lifecycle, integrating data analytics, failure analysis, and corrective action to improve product reliability and reduce warranty cost. This role bridges field performance with engineering by identifying trends, determining root cause, and driving cross-functional solutions across design, manufacturing, and suppliers.

The ideal candidate will possess the following knowledge, skills and abilities:
- Strong analytical skills with experience in Excel, SQL, and/or BI tools (Power BI, Tableau)
- Proficiency in root cause analysis methodologies (8D, 5 Whys, FMEA)
- Experience with reliability testing, failure analysis, and product validation
- Familiarity with ERP and warranty management systems
- Problem-solving and critical thinking
- Cross-functional leadership and influence
- Strong communication skills (technical and executive-level)
- Attention to detail with ability to synthesize complex data
- Ability to operate in a fast-paced, evolving environment
Preferred Qualifications:
- Experience in automotive, battery, energy storage, or related industry strongly preferred
- Proven experience with both data analysis and technical failure investigation
